KATHLEEN "KATHY" ALFREDA FINK

Kathleen “Kathy” Alfreda Fink,  70,  of Green Spring, WV,  passed away peacefully at home surrounded by her family to be with Christ our Lord, Wednesday, August 24, 2011.  She was born on July 27, 1941 in Baltimore, MD, the  daughter of the late George and Catherine (Shuman) Holden, Sr.  Besides her parents “Kathy” was preceded in death by one son, Joseph Davis; two grandchildren, Brandy Davis and Joseph Golden; and one great grandchild, Anastasia Elliott.

“Kathy” was a faithful member of Mt. Zion Church and had known Jesus Christ as her Savior.  She retired in 2004 from Hampshire Manufacturing, Romney, WV;  was a devoted wife and mother and “Kathy”  was loved by all.

GERALD IRVIN LARGENT

Gerald Irvin Largent,  75,  of Romney, WV,  died August 17, 2011 at the Winchester Medical Center, Winchester, VA.  Gerald was born on February 4, 1936 in Three Churches, WV,  the son of  the late  Irvin Hensel and Myrtle Creola (Kidner) Largent.  In addition to his parents  he was preceded in death by one granddaughter, Samantha Marie Grady.

Gerald began his career as a truck driver at the age of 16 and retired in 2009.  During this span of 59 years, he drove for Hill Top Fruit Market and Dennis Lupton Trucking.

JOHN MONROE AVERY

John Monroe Avery,  79,  of Romney, WV,  died on August 17, 2011 at the VA Center, Martinsburg, WV.   Mr. Avery was born on January 26, l932 in Clayton County, GA, the   son of the late David Monroe and Frances Ola Washington Avery.  He  retired from the U.S. Navy as Chief Hospital Medical Corpsman in 1968;  a realtor for Century 21 for 20 years and owned and operated the Pioneer Restaurant for 14 years.  Mr. Avery was a member of the American Legion Hampshire Post 91, the VFW Wappocomo Post 1101, the Loyal Order of the Moose #1371 and the Lions Club all of Romney.

RAY EMERSON MILLER

Ray Emerson Miller, 55, of Green Spring, WV was ushered into heaven from his home on August 8, 2011.  He was born on October 8, 1955 in Berkeley Springs, WV to the late Donald and Reba Miller of Short Gap, WV.  Ray was also preceded in death by his sister, Kathy D. Clark of Everett, PA.  In addition to being an extraordinary man of God, Ray was an amazing husband to his beloved wife, Brenda S. Frye, of 37 years; a loving father to his son, Joshua Ray Miller, and his wife, Raven A. Miller of Springfield, WV and to his sweet daughter, Jody Leigh Ansel, and her husband, John M. Ansel, of Springfield, WV; a playful “Paps” to his special grandsons, Tanner Gracen Ansel and Lincoln Asay Miller; a wonderful son-in-law to his “Sunshine”, Mary D. Frye, of Green Spring, WV; a devoted brother to Ronald and Judy Miller of Shermansdale, PA and Marian K. Clark of Short Gap, WV; a loyal brother-in-law to Tim and Lisa Frye of Springfield, WV and Robert “Pete” and Gail Nixon of Springfield, WV; as well as an incredible uncle, nephew, cousin, and friend to many.

Ray was a 1973 graduate of Fort Ashby High School.  He was a self-employed business owner of Miller’s Carpet and Flooring Installation.  He was a master mason of the Clinton Lodge No. 86 in Romney, WV.  Ray was an avid outdoorsman and was a member of the High Ridge Hunting Club.  He served as a deacon and greeter for the Springfield Assembly of God church.  He took great pride in serving the Lord by using his many gifts and talents to further the Kingdom of God.
